High-Net-Worth divorce cases involve significant assets, financial complexity, and high-stakes decisions that can impact your long-term financial security. These cases often include business interests, investments, retirement accounts, real estate holdings, and other high-value assets that must be carefully evaluated and divided.

Asset Valuation and Financial Analysis

Accurate valuation is often critical in high-net-worth divorce cases. When necessary, we work closely with:

  • Certified Public Accountants (CPAs)
  • Forensic accountants
  • Business valuation experts
  • Real estate appraisers
  • Financial professionals

A high-net-worth divorce generally involves significant assets such as businesses, investment portfolios, retirement accounts, real estate holdings, or other high-value property.

These cases often involve complicated valuation issues, financial analysis, business ownership interests, and substantial assets that require careful evaluation and planning.

Because significant financial interests are involved, experienced legal representation can help ensure assets are properly identified, valued, and protected throughout the divorce process.

Business interests can be subject to valuation and analysis. The specific treatment depends on the facts of the case and the nature of the ownership interest.

Yes. Appraisers, accountants, business valuation professionals, and other experts are frequently involved in high net worth divorce cases when necessary.
